I have just discovered the catalytic convertor is rusted and has holes. Can't pass inspection this month.

The Ford Dealer want $1000 to replace. Other's can't get the part as it is only a dealer item. $750

Anyone out there resolve it for a better price?

1999 Contour LX 4cyl. Runs great as always 154000 + miles.

Originally posted by SpliceVW:
$69 from CTA motorsports for the 2.5" magnaflow. Its not a direct replacement (there's some welding) but shouldn't be too expensive for an exhaust shop.




Seeing as to how he has a Zetec the magnaflow cat can't go in the factory location you will have to put it under the car like it is on the V6 which isn't that big of a deal don't let the exhaust shop charge u an arm and a leg to get it done. I know because I have the same cat on my car and mine is also a Zetec.

Sheesh, it's so hard. I really don't want to offend anyone's reading skills, but this always happens whenever you ask some Zetec -specific cat or exhaust question.. a number of helpful guys will jump in and offer handy&cheap Duratec -specific solutions.

Just to make it clear:

The Zetec and Duratec exhaust setup (i.e. catalytic converters) are different in many ways. For example there's NO pre-cat in a 4cyl setup, NO universal-fit cat can be used (unique shape cat), there's no cheap aftermarket cat for Zetecs (*), and it indeed costs $600-800 from a dealer.

Try to get a used one from a junkyard.
